That would be the first choice, the transitive property of congruence
How did I get it? I just know my properties of relations:
The usually definitions apply to equality; congruence is essentially the same thing.
Reflexive Property: a=a
Symmetric Property: If a=b then b=a
Transitive Property: If a=b and b=c then a=c
When a relation is reflexive, symmetric and transitive it is called an equivalence relation and it divides the elements into equivalence classes.
Distributive Property. There is no distributive property of equality or congruence. The distributive property of multiplication over addition states: a(b+c)=ab+ac.
